Preparation for Access to HE - Level 2
Overview
Prepare for university with essential GCSEs.
If you're an adult (19+) and want to go to university but don’t yet have GCSE English or maths at grade 4-9 (C or above) to qualify for an Access to HE course, this course is for you.
Designed to help you achieve the GCSE you need, this programme also builds your confidence and prepares you for the expectations of an Access to HE course in small, supportive and friendly classes. You'll also develop key social skills essential for university life.
Over the course of a year, you'll study a range of topics tailored to support your future career goals.

What will I study?
- Biology
- Psychology
- Sociology
- Communication skills
- Maths
- Study skills.
Start date, attendance and fee
- Start date - September 2026
- Attendance - One and a half days per week
- Fee - Free or £30.
